The Big Picture

Organized retail crime (ORC) is evolving fast—blending in-store theft with digital fraud. Retailers making progress through tougher laws, AI, and collaboration, but big gaps remain.

Key Challenges

  • Retailers still silo store vs. e-comm investigations
  • ORC definition is outdated, focused mainly on physical theft
  • Too many platforms for intelligence sharing—no single standard
  • AI fraud tactics (deepfakes, social engineering) are advancing rapidly

Emerging Solutions

  • AI video analytics for faster theft detection
  • Unified commerce + loss orchestration: merge data, teams, and systems
  • Federal push for broader fraud/ORC intelligence sharing
  • Solution providers teaming up across physical + digital

Bottom Line

Progress is real, but uneven. The future of fighting ORC lies in unifying channels, data, and defenses—and moving from reactive whac-a-mole to proactive, AI-powered prevention.
